CEO of Madagascar Oil heard from

The CEO of Madagascar Oil, Russell Kelly, heard this weekend by the criminal brigade, explained himself during a press conference. The man indicates that the majority owner of Madagascar Oil, the Benchmark group, would have been contacted via email by Paul Rafanoharana -Franco-Malgache arrested on Tuesday, July 20, to jeopardize state security.

In this email, Paul Rafanoharana claimed funding of € 10 million for political destabilization. The email was addressed to the majority owner of Madagascar Oil, Benchmark Group. As a reminder, Madagascar Oil has the largest heavy oil resources in the country, with the Tsimiroro and Bemolanga fields.

The general management never responded to this request. This was told by Russell Kelly, head of Mada Oil, to the police on Saturday 24 July and during a press conference yesterday Monday, where no questions were asked. However, the management of the Benchmark Group did not warn the Malagasy authorities about what was happening; the exact content of the email in question was not disclosed, nor was the date of the correspondence.

Investigations continue in this case of attacks on state security where two French people were arrested on July 20. According to the prosecutor, the investigators have physical evidence that Paul Rafanoharana, a French-Malagasy, and Philippe François, a French, planned to assassinate “senior politicians”, including the President of the Republic, Andry Rajoelina. A third person was arrested this weekend from a source close to the case. This is Philippe François and Paul Rafanoharana partners in Tsarafirst Investment Fund.
